And computers are really literal systems that just adhere to the specific directions you give them. When the area first started they focused on points that sounded intelligent. And they really ended up being a little less complicated than one may have expected. In 1961, James Slagle released a PhD thesis on a program that had the ability to ace a calculus examination. Many of the hardest problems in expert system are in fact not the things you find out in colleges and textbooks. Where MACS can be found in, is it serves as an added filter in this associate selection channel. So currently as opposed to sending out every client via to abstraction to verify metastatic disease, we initially send out the patients to a version where the model will certainly outcome whether it thinks that the patient is metastatic. If the design believes the client is metastatic then every little thing continues as it did previously, where an abstractor will certainly still verify the patient is metastatic prior to the person winds up in the friend. Whereas if the design thinks that Goal Setting the individual is not metastatic then the individual is eliminated from the associate and no more abstraction is done.
